Servings: 4

Ingredients

  • Pizza dough (1 pound)
  • Pizza sauce (1 cup)
  • Mozzarella cheese, shredded (2 cups)
  • Pastrami, sliced (8 ounces)
  • Pineapple, diced (1 cup)
  • Olive oil (1 tablespoon)
  • Salt (to taste)
  • Pepper (to taste)

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 475°F (245°C). If you have a pizza stone, place it in the oven while it preheats to achieve a crispy crust.
  2. On a floured surface, roll out the pizza dough to your desired thickness, ensuring an even shape.
  3. Spread the pizza sauce evenly over the dough, leaving a small border around the edges for a crunchy crust.
  4. Sprinkle half of the shredded mozzarella cheese over the sauce to create a cheesy base.
  5. Evenly arrange the sliced pastrami and diced pineapple over the cheese, ensuring every bite gets a balance of flavor.
  6. Top with the remaining mozzarella cheese for that gooey, melty finish.
  7. Drizzle the assembled pizza with olive oil and season generously with salt and pepper to enhance the flavors.
  8. Carefully transfer the pizza to the preheated oven or onto the pizza stone and bake for 12-15 minutes, until the crust is golden brown and the cheese is bubbly and slightly browned.
  9. Once baked, remove the pizza from the oven and let it cool for a few minutes before slicing to prevent burns and ensure perfect slices.

Dietary Information

Servings: 4 • Dish Type: Main Course • Prep Time: 15 minutes • Cook Time: 15 minutes • Calories: 450 • Fat: 20g • Carbs: 45g • Protein: 22g • Sodium: 900mg • Sugar: 5g
